数据完整性控制:Access2010教程详解
需积分: 31 181 浏览量
更新于2024-08-23
收藏 2.19MB PPT 举报
数据完整性控制是Access 2010基础教程中的关键概念,它确保在数据库中存储的数据具有正确性、合法性和一致性。在数据库设计和管理中,数据完整性是至关重要的,因为它减少了错误和不一致性,提高了数据的可靠性和有效性。
1. 实体完整性规则:在关系数据库中,每个实体的主键(即唯一标识符)必须是唯一的,并且不能为空。这是为了防止数据冗余和冲突,确保数据的唯一性。
2. 用户定义的完整性:这是一种更高级别的约束,允许用户自定义针对特定业务规则的数据约束条件。例如,可以设置限制年龄范围、邮箱格式等,确保数据符合特定的业务逻辑。
3. 参照完整性规则:在关系模型中,不同关系表之间的数据依赖通过外键关联。当在一个表中修改或删除引用另一个表的记录时,参照完整性规则会确保被引用的记录存在或者符合相应的约束,从而维护数据一致性。
数据库基础部分讲述了数据处理技术的发展历程,从手工管理阶段的数据不保存、与程序紧密耦合,到文件系统阶段的数据分离和一定程度的共享,再到数据库阶段的集中存储、共享和管理,以及DBMS(数据库管理系统)的引入,极大地提高了数据管理和处理的效率。
分布式数据库系统将数据库分布在多个计算机节点上,既保持物理上的独立性又保持逻辑上的整体性,体现了数据库技术与计算机网络技术的融合。面向对象数据库则引入了程序设计中的对象概念,数据和操作方法作为对象统一管理,支持更复杂的数据结构和查询。
图书馆是一个实际应用数据库的例子,它通过科学地组织、存储图书,实现高效的检索和管理,同时确保数据的安全性和共享。图书馆的规则和数据库技术结合,确保数据的正确使用,比如限制借阅权限、避免数据冗余等。
总结来说,数据完整性控制在Access 2010中扮演着核心角色,它通过各种规则和策略保护数据的质量,确保数据在多变的业务环境中保持一致性和可靠性。掌握这些规则和原理对于有效使用数据库系统至关重要。
2022-11-24 上传
268 浏览量
431 浏览量
2022-11-23 上传
2010-05-11 上传
2022-10-23 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
xxxibb
- 粉丝: 22
- 资源: 2万+
最新资源
- vip会员统计表excel模版下载
- containerBooking
- like-me
- node-async-await-example:具有异步等待用法的Node.js应用程序的简单示例
- F460dll_for_TOT_KLS.rar
- NRRD 格式文件阅读器:NRRD 文件阅读器-matlab开发
- upptime:Up Upptime的正常运行时间监视器和状态页面,由@upptime提供支持
- 幼儿园财务报表excel模版下载
- Calculator:在Android Studio上使用Kotlin的基本计算器
- luckytuan-fast-loader-master.zip
- adc-analysis:SciCRT的跟踪分析
- SCANProject:堆叠式交叉注意项目页面
- 公司会议室3D模型
- pushNaNs:将 NaN 推送到 X 的每一列的底部。-matlab开发
- ManuelGil:个人资料
- 爱普生(Epson)L805 原版清零软件